About the provider

The Fort Bliss Spouses' Association (FBSA) is a non-profit organization that supports the spouses of military personnel stationed at Fort Bliss, Texas. Established to foster a sense of community among military families, the FBSA provides resources, social events, and volunteer opportunities to enhance the quality of life for its members. The association aims to promote camaraderie and support among spouses, helping them navigate the unique challenges of military life. Through various programs and initiatives, the FBSA also engages in philanthropic efforts to give back to the Fort Bliss community and beyond.
